    Fallin' is a song by American singer-songwriter Alicia Keys from her debut studio album Songs in A Minor (2001). It was released as the lead single from Songs in A Minor in April 2, 2001. Written and produced by Keys, "Fallin'" is generally considered her signature song."Fallin'" attained global success, reaching number one on the US Billboard Hot 100 and the top 5 in several countries. It also received numerous certifications around the world, and is one of the best-selling singles of 2001. In 2009, "Fallin'" was named the 29th most successful song of the 2000s, on the Billboard Hot 100 Songs of the Decade. It won three Grammy Awards in 2002, including Song of the Year, Best R&B Song, and Best Female R&B Vocal Performance, and was also nominated for Record of the Year.

  1. FALLIN

    According to the U.S. Census Bureau, Fallin is ranked #14064 in terms of the most common surnames in America.

    The Fallin surname appeared 2,140 times in the 2010 census and if you were to sample 100,000 people in the United States, approximately 1 would have the surname Fallin.

    83.7% or 1,793 total occurrences were White.
    9.3% or 201 total occurrences were Black.
    2.5% or 54 total occurrences were of two or more races.
    2.3% or 51 total occurrences were of Hispanic origin.
    1.2% or 26 total occurrences were American Indian or Alaskan Native.
    0.7% or 15 total occurrences were Asian.
